The strongest flare in last 24 hours was the M1.5 flare (peaking at 12:25 UT) on December 5. The M-class flare was one more confined flare (SOHO/LASCO observations show data gap, however the SDO/AIA data do not show any on-disc signatures of the CME) which originated from the Catania sunspot group 24 (NOAA AR 2222). No Earth directed CMEs were observed during last 24 hours. We expect C-class flares and possibly also isolated M-class flares from the Catania sunspot group 24 (NOAA AR 2222) which still maintains beta-gamma configuration of its photospheric magnetic field. Since this active region is approaching to the west solar limb (about S20 W58), eruptions and flaring activity originating from this active region might be accompanied with the particle event. We maintain the warning conditions for a proton event. The solar wind speed is currently about 480 km/s. The slow increase of the solar wind speed and density, concurrent with the strong increase of interplanetary magnetic field has started early today. The interplanetary magnetic field magnitude is elevated during the last 5 hours and it amounts about 21 nT, indicating possible arrival of the ICME of still unclear solar origin. If the Bz component of the interplanetary magnetic field turns to negative values we might expect active to minor storm geomagnetic conditions.
Today's estimated international sunspot number (ISN): 046, based on 16 stations.
